WebNov 17, 2024 · Add additional grass pads around the porch potty to increase the overall size of the potty area for a while. Sometimes when the space is too small a dog won't use it, especially at first. If the area the potty is in is pretty confined related to pup's size then that may also be an issue, and anything you can do to make the area more open can help. If your dog won't potty on the grass, suspect a substrate preference being the culprit. Yes, dogs can have preferences when it comes to potty areas, and it sometimes all boils down to how they were introduced to potty areas when the dogs were pups. Adrienne Farricelli CPDT-KA.
